30. he FLY World Admin account you can do the following e Select Pentop users fo manage e Set browsing and purchasing permissions for Pentop users e Add value for Pentop users so they make FLY World Download Store purchases e Edit your account e mail and credit card information e Purchase FLY Fusion software and subscriptions for Pentop users e There can only be one FLY World Admin account for each instance of the FLY World application To remove an existing Admin account all you need to do is log on with another authorized Admin account see But remember the Pentop users on that computer won t be available for management by the new Admin account until the former Admin account releases them see i FLY WORLD APPLICATION v1 0 6 FLY WORLD PROFILES AND ACCOUNTS There are three types of accounts that can log on to the FLY World application Pentop Profile FLY World Admin account and Guest Profile Pentop Profile A Pentop Profile is a unique user profile on your computer that associates you with your FLY Fusion Pentop Computer The FLY World application supports multiple Pentop Profiles so multiple Pentop Computers can be registered with your copy of the FLY World application This makes it easy for family and friends each with his or her own Pentop Computer to use the same copy of the FLY World application Each Pentop Profile consists of its own secure library of files notebooks and applications FLY Fusion software
31. is a bit different from adding and removing applications You can add MP3s that are stored anywhere on you personal computer And when you remove MP3s from your Pentop Computer or Cartridge they aren t backed up by the FLY World application and are just deleted So be sure to keep backups of your MP3s on your personal computer separately you can always add them back onto your Pentop Computer or Cartridge later To add MP3s to your Pentop Computer or Cartridge 1 Click the Add MP3 button 2 Navigate to the folder on your personal computer where you keep your MP3s FLY WORLD APPLICATION v1 0 33 3 select the MP3s you want and click Open 4 Wait and be patient while the FLY World application imports the selected MP3s The selected MP8s are added to the Pentop list or the Cartridge list accordingly These changes aren t saved to your Pentop Computer or your Cartridge until you click the Sync Pentop button see TIP If FLY World can t add the music files you ve selected to your Pentop Computer it s usually because the files you ve selected are either protected or an invalid MP3 format NOTE In order for MP3s to be playable on your Pentop Computer the FLY World application needs to transcode them Be patient when adding MP3s to your Pentop Computer the transcoding process takes Time To delete MP3s from your Pentop Computer or Cartridge 1 select the MP3s you want to remove by selecting their checkboxes in

46. s and other countries FLY WORLD APPLICATION v1 0 3 Q F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S Why doesn t the FLY World application recognize my FLY Fusion Pentop Computer even though it is connected Be sure that your Pentop Computer is powered on If it isn t on your personal computer and the FLY World application can t recognize it How can be sure my FLY Fusion Pentop Computer is powered on The light on your Pentop Computer turns yellow when powered on and plugged into your personal computer When powered on and not plugged in the light turns green And when it is connected and charging but not powered on the light turns red How do I create a Pentop Profile see Creating a Pentop Profile How do I create a FLY World Admin account See What are FLY World updates and why should accept them FLY World updates are occasional software updates for the FLY World application You should accept and install these updates in order to stay current with software improvements to the FLY World application the FLY World Download Store and your FLY Fusion Pentop Computer If there are any updates for your FLY Fusion software the word UPDATE will appear next to the application name on the Pentop tab Why does the FLY World application fail to launch If your personal computer uses a firewall for example McAfee Personal Firewall and certain ports are blocked the FLY World application won t launch You l
